Tyna Robertson: A Story of Controversy, Tragedy, and Public Attention

Tyna Robertson, also known as Tyna Karageorge, is an American woman whose life has been marked by public attention due to her relationships, legal disputes, and personal tragedies. Her connection to former NFL star Brian Urlacher, her involvement in high-profile lawsuits, and her experiences navigating parenthood and immense challenges have kept her in the media spotlight for years. The Relationship with Brian Urlacher

Tyna Robertson is best known for her brief relationship with Brian Urlacher, the legendary linebacker for the Chicago Bears and an inductee into the Pro Football Hall of Fame. The two were romantically linked in 2004, and their relationship, though short-lived, resulted in the birth of their son, Kennedy Urlacher, in 2005.

The Defamation Lawsuit Against Brian Urlacher

In 2018, Robertson filed a defamation lawsuit against Urlacher, alleging that he had made false and damaging statements about her character. She claimed that Urlacher, in collaboration with attorneys and a reporter, had portrayed her as an unfit mother and even a murderer. The lawsuit demanded $125 million in damages—$100 million in punitive damages and $25 million in compensatory damages—making it one of the most significant legal actions connected to her public life.

Robertson argued that these accusations not only damaged her reputation but also impacted her personal and professional life. The Tragic Incident with Ryan Karageorge

In 2016, Robertson married Ryan Karageorge, a man who became a central figure in a tragedy that would once again place her in the public eye. On December 29, 2016, during an argument at their home, Karageorge died from a gunshot wound to the head. The incident was ruled accidental, but its aftermath had significant implications for Robertson’s life.

The tragic event raised questions about safety and stability in Robertson’s home, particularly with Kennedy living under her care. Brian Urlacher responded by filing an emergency motion in court, expressing concerns about Kennedy’s welfare. The incident further intensified the legal battles between Robertson and Urlacher, adding another layer of complexity to their strained relationship.
